Output 304af9ad21dc40a9d6a54efdebbb5842463ffd88b525158957da4f5fe53cc21f:6

value
7575642
script pubkey
OP_0 OP_PUSHBYTES_20 66d59f7979e3ab43913719d75714e3fb3d30835a
address
bc1qvm2e77teuw458yfhr8t4w98rlv7npq667lzhlv
transaction
304af9ad21dc40a9d6a54efdebbb5842463ffd88b525158957da4f5fe53cc21f
spent
true